Tera Patrick Goes On Playboy TV, Radio

LOS ANGELES — Playboy has announced that adult star Tera Patrick will host “School of Sex,” a sex advice show on Playboy TV, as well as new Playboy radio program “Rock Star, Porn Star,” which will feature Patrick interviewing music celebrities.

The radio program began airing last night on the Playboy Channel, hosted on Sirius satellite radio. The TV series is slated to start airing in September.

“I am thrilled to be back working with Playboy TV to host this new series,” Patrick said.

“‘School of Sex’ is a hot and informative show where I get to share sex secrets with viewers from swinger etiquette to intimate details on how to please your partner. Playboy TV played a huge role in helping me cross over to a mainstream audience and I look forward to continued success with them.”

The new, original “School of Sex” show is based on a popular Spanish-language show that appeared originally on Playboy TV Latin America.

Viewers will have the opportunity to write in questions, and Patrick will offer advice and even demonstrations with a “sex demonstration team.”

“Rock Star, Porn Star” will be co-hosted by Patrick and rocker husband Evan Seinfeld, as they interview mainstream celebrities including Dave Navarro, Matt Sorum, Margaret Cho and Kat Von D, and adult star like Jenna Haze, Shy Love, Brooke Haven and Kayla Paige. The show will focus on people that live “life in the fast lane,” discussing a wide variety of topics, from politics to social issues and adult-oriented material.

“As a frequent guest on Playboy Radio I’ve always wanted to do my own show,” Patrick said. “Evan and I will be calling all of our celebrity friends to share some of their wildest stories with the Playboy Radio listeners.”

“And we promise to uncover the big secret about why rock stars always date porn stars,” Patrick added.

The announcement by Playboy is among several projects involving Patrick that have been rolled out this week.

Through June 18, Patrick will be featured in Women’s Entertainment (WE) Network’s “Secret Lives of Women” documentary series.

The star also announced a collaboration with high-end T-shirt designer PJE, to launch a line of men’s T-shirts that will be branded with iconic images of Patrick, and sold in upscale boutiques including trendy Kitson, in Los Angeles.

Patrick and Seinfeld will host a party this Tuesday at the House of Blues on the Sunset Strip in Hollywood, celebrating the Playboy deal, as well as Patrick’s upcoming appearance on cover of High Times magazine.
